Romaine and Orange Salad With Orange-Dill Dressing

I found this recipe in a cookbook of blue-ribbon winners from Nashville, Tennessee cooking contests. The combination of oranges and steak sauce with romaine combine to make an unusual but delicious recipe. We love it! Show more

Ready In: 15 mins

Serves: 6

Directions

  1. Place lettuce in a large salad bowl. In a small bowl, combine orange juice, steak sauce, lemon juice and seasonings; mix well.
  2. Gradually add oil, whisking constantly. Pour 1/2 cup of the dressing over lettuce; toss to coat. Add oranges, nuts and cheese; gently toss. Serve remaining dressing on the side, for those who want to add more salad dressing.
